Abstract
This paper investigates and compares the effects of e-learning, b(lended)- learning, and traditional classroom learning on Korean college students’ acquisition of the subject knowledge of a content course and on the improvement of their general English proficiency. Three intact classes were taught in English through the three respective ways and their acquisition of the content knowledge was measured through a final exam which contained different types of questions. The students’ English proficiency was also measured through a TOEIC-type paper test before and after the semester. The results of the study revealed the superiority of b-learning over e-learning and traditional classroom face-to-face learning in the acquisition of content knowledge. However, the change of the students’ English proficiency showed no significant differences between the three different types of learning.
